What is peak-to-Valley difference (PVD)?
The peak-to-valley difference (PVD) is selected as the optimization objective, and the charge and discharge capacity of the BESS is calculated according to the immediate output of clean energy power generation and load changes, to suppress the fluctuations from the renewable energy.

What happens during peak period of electricity price?
During the peak period of electricity price, the sum of V2G scheduling cost and additional charging cost (the charging cost required for the amount of discharged electricity by V2G) is lower than the electricity price, and the charging station controls the EVs to discharge.
